Subject: gpiolib: introduce fwnode_gpiod_get_index()
Git-commit: 13949fa9daa91a60c7cfef40755f7611cc2cf653
Patch-mainline: v5.5-rc1
References: bsc#1152489

This introduces fwnode_gpiod_get_index() that iterates through common gpio
suffixes when trying to locate a GPIO within a given firmware node.

We also switch devm_fwnode_gpiod_get_index() to call
fwnode_gpiod_get_index() instead of iterating through GPIO suffixes on
its own.

 /**
+ * fwnode_gpiod_get_index - obtain a GPIO from firmware node
+ * @fwnode:	handle of the firmware node
+ * @con_id:	function within the GPIO consumer
+ * @index:	index of the GPIO to obtain for the consumer
+ * @flags:	GPIO initialization flags
+ * @label:	label to attach to the requested GPIO
+ *
+ * This function can be used for drivers that get their configuration
+ * from opaque firmware.
+ *
+ * The function properly finds the corresponding GPIO using whatever is the
+ * underlying firmware interface and then makes sure that the GPIO
+ * descriptor is requested before it is returned to the caller.
+ *
+ * Returns:
+ * On successful request the GPIO pin is configured in accordance with
+ * provided @flags.
+ *
+ * In case of error an ERR_PTR() is returned.
+ */
+struct gpio_desc *fwnode_gpiod_get_index(struct fwnode_handle *fwnode,
+					 const char *con_id, int index,
+					 enum gpiod_flags flags,
+					 const char *label)
+{
+	struct gpio_desc *desc;
+	char prop_name[32]; /* 32 is max size of property name */
+	unsigned int i;
+
+	for (i = 0; i < ARRAY_SIZE(gpio_suffixes); i++) {
+		if (con_id)
+			snprintf(prop_name, sizeof(prop_name), "%s-%s",
+					    con_id, gpio_suffixes[i]);
+		else
+			snprintf(prop_name, sizeof(prop_name), "%s",
+					    gpio_suffixes[i]);
+
+		desc = fwnode_get_named_gpiod(fwnode, prop_name, index, flags,
+					      label);
+		if (!IS_ERR(desc) || (PTR_ERR(desc) != -ENOENT))
+			break;
+	}
+
+	return desc;
+}
+EXPORT_SYMBOL_GPL(fwnode_gpiod_get_index);
